			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>99% of you will have had at least one frustrating experience waiting for a very long time to get connected to a customer service representative. FastCustomer wants to help you out by saving you the waiting time.</p>
<p>It has a huge number of firms listed in its iPhone and Android app, and you just need to select the one you want to talk to, and press &#8220;Have someone call me.&#8221; FastCustomer automatically goes through the IVR options, waits to get the employee on the line and then connects you to them.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Explaining the Internet to a web illiterate or somebody who is new to computers is not easy. Teaching them how to reach their email, online photos, or social networking account can be quite difficult. To simplify and ease the process, you can get help from a site called Internet Buttons.</p>
<p><img src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/dir/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/internetbuttons.png?570cd5" alt="web illiterate" /></p>
<p>Internet Buttons is a free to use website. The site lets you place brightly colored buttons on a webpage. These buttons act as shortcuts to other URLs. You choose how many buttons to place on your webpage; your selection is saved through the account you create. You can name the buttons whatever you want and choose a different color for each button. Through a public URL to your buttons page you can access the startpage from anywhere.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Creating a web app or any web based business is only the first step. Then comes the responsibility of managing it and resolving any technical issues that may arise from time to time. JazzDesk is a help desk online that allows you to do exactly that. Using JazzDesk you can create support tickets, share them with your team and manage them online.</p>
<p>You can assign tickets to different team members, specify a list of activities for each ticket and assign team members to each activity. You can also sort tickets in your dashboard by status such as started, on hold and waiting. New users can be added, deleted and assigned to tickets by the admin. All the activities related to a ticket can be timed, tracked and commented on for easy collaboration.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Many of us may have experienced being held up for a ridiculous amount of time whenever we call a customer service number. This precious time spent waiting on hold could be used somewhere else productively. Sometimes, we may even find ourselves dropping the call when the waiting time becomes too much.</p>
<p>LucyPhone is a free web service that acts as a customer telephone switchboard so that you don&#8217;t have to wait on hold again when calling customer service.</p>
<p><img src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/dir/wp-content/uploads/2010/05/image_thumb41.png?570cd5" alt="waiting on hold" /></p>
<p>To use LucyPhone, go to the website and search for a company name or type any toll-free number. Then enter your phone number and click the <em>start</em> button to initiate the service. LucyPhone will call you first then patch you through to the company. Interact with the company&#8217;s phone menu normally and once you are put on hold, just press ** and your call will be disconnected.</p>
<p>Once an agent is available on the line to talk to you, LucyPhone will call you back straight away and connect you to the customer service representative. You may also repeat pressing ** when you are put on hold again.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Support Details is a website which instantly provides technical details about any system. It runs different tests on the user&#8217;s machine to gather data about the operating system and internet browser. It lists details such as the operating system in use, the screen resolution, IP address and color depth. You can use this tool to obtain detailed system information from computers of non techie users who are not able to provide it themselves.</p>
<p><img src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/dir/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/support-details1.png?570cd5" alt="system information" /></p>
<p>Apart from system information, it also gives you details about the web browser such as the browser size, whether JavaScript and cookies are enabled or disabled, and the Flash version in use.</p>
<p>The best part is that you can copy each of the details as text, if need be. Once the data is gathered, users can quickly send this information to an e-mail address, or they can export the report as a PDF or CSV file.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>ServerFault is a user contributed Q &amp; A site for system administrators, IT professionals or anyone who has to deal with server problems and network related issues. Users can ask and answer question without registration. To vote on questions and answers sign up is needed.</p>
<p>Questions are sorted according to their popularity, as measured by the number of views, answers and votes. Users can browse questions by tags, by popularity or search topics using site search engine.</p>
<p>Active members can collect reputation points and enjoy further editing privileges, which includes retagging others&#8217; questions, creating new tags, editing user posts and more.</p>
